Gestion des Fichiers txt

sehn Messages postés 41 Date d'inscription mardi 16 avril 2002 Statut Membre Dernière intervention 8 octobre 2004 - 2 janv. 2003 à 14:25
sehn Messages postés 41 Date d'inscription mardi 16 avril 2002 Statut Membre Dernière intervention 8 octobre 2004 - 2 janv. 2003 à 18:29
Quelqu'un connait il une maniere en VB de lire les 50 dernieres lignes d'un fichier texte sans le parcourir en entier.
Mon fichier texte fait 3 MegaOctets, il est donc long a parcourir.

Merci

Sehn

3 réponses

Nektanebos Messages postés 62 Date d'inscription mercredi 4 décembre 2002 Statut Membre Dernière intervention 27 avril 2003
2 janv. 2003 à 15:07
Soit c'est un fichier structuré et tu le lis en random en établissant les champs ou soit c'est un fichier non structuré et tu le lis en binaire en établissant la variable receptrice

dim strdata as string * 10

open "nomfichier" for binary as #1

et tu le lis comme ceci :

get #1, numéro de caractère(octet), strdata
0
Nektanebos Messages postés 62 Date d'inscription mercredi 4 décembre 2002 Statut Membre Dernière intervention 27 avril 2003
2 janv. 2003 à 15:07
Soit c'est un fichier structuré et tu le lis en random en établissant les champs ou soit c'est un fichier non structuré et tu le lis en binaire en établissant la variable receptrice

dim strdata as string * 255

open "nomfichier" for binary as #1

et tu le lis comme ceci :

get #1, numéro de caractère(octet), strdata
0
sehn Messages postés 41 Date d'inscription mardi 16 avril 2002 Statut Membre Dernière intervention 8 octobre 2004
2 janv. 2003 à 18:29
Merci tu me sauves la vie
Sehn
:big)
0
Rejoignez-nous